Output 526ef9149471d721f79dbd80d1d44f9740a439bd21385a9cd081bb55e4b77123:0

value
1742000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b57c15d5d0bcbc283564e2eda95a3edeaef7f308 OP_EQUAL
address
3JEcsrySHVX9mP9Mz4s5e97aF6F9Kdfh4L
transaction
526ef9149471d721f79dbd80d1d44f9740a439bd21385a9cd081bb55e4b77123
spent
true